CIFF – Cittadella International Film Festival is an international film event held in the stunning medieval town of Cittadella (Padua, Italy)—a walled city rich in history, culture, and architectural beauty.
The festival is dedicated to promoting independent cinema from around the world, giving space to emerging filmmakers and established artists who craft stories that move, challenge, and inspire.
The prestigious Malta’s Tower Award (Premio Torre di Malta) is the festival’s top honor, awarded to the film that best exemplifies narrative innovation, visual impact, and artistic excellence. The award is named after the historic "Torre di Malta," a medieval landmark that stands as a symbol of the city’s cultural heritage.
CIFF welcomes short films, documentaries, feature films, experimental cinema, and animation, across all genres and languages. Screenings take place in spectacular historic venues, offering a cinematic experience deeply rooted in place and tradition.
CIFF is more than a festival—it’s a hub for exchange, with masterclasses, industry panels, Q&A sessions, and networking opportunities designed to connect creators and audiences worldwide.

5. Submission Guidelines
Submissions must be made exclusively via Festhome and include:
Full technical details
Short synopsis (max 500 characters)
Trailer (optional but recommended)
English subtitles (mandatory if the original language is not English or Italian)
6. Eligibility
Films must have been completed after January 1st, 2023
No nationality restrictions
Submission implies full acceptance of the present rules
7. Selection
All submissions will be evaluated by the CIFF Artistic Committee. Selected filmmakers will be notified via email. Selected works will be screened during the festival.
8. Screenings
The festival will take place in person, with the possibility of an online component. Filmmakers must provide high-quality screening copies in the required formats.
9. Rights and Responsibilities
Entrants are responsible for the content of their work and must hold all rights necessary for public exhibition. CIFF reserves the right to use promotional materials and excerpts for non-commercial festival promotion.
